Sam sipped hot chocolate and rolled the cold dreidel necklace between her fingers as her family set up for a movie day, their annual rewatch of Prince of Egypt. It was the last day of Hanukkah, and after such a relaxing holiday, Sam felt comfortable and excited for a couple weeks without school.

The song "Through Heaven's Eyes" hit her especially hard this year. There were miracles everywhere: big ones like the miracle of oil, strange ones like the existence of ghosts, and little ones, too. Good food and good friends. Old menorahs and repurposed sweaters, ancient traditions and new ones. Seeds waiting to sprout under the snow, and small lights pushing back darkness.

Tomorrow, she was going to surprise Tucker and Danny with an early copy of Doomed 64 that she'd bought on the down low from a kid whose father was on the development team.

Today, Sam would just rest and bask in family—she even found herself looking forward to their dinner tonight. They had their issues, sometimes, but Hanukkah had brought many reminders of the light and love that were woven into it, too.
